The U.S. Department of Energy (DOE) is proposing to provide funding to The Rapid Advancement in Process Intensification Deployment Manufacturing Institute (RAPID) to coordinate, organize, and support activities related to education and workforce development and future technological development projects, however, the current effort is limited to project and portfolio management for the technological development program.

A previous NEPA Determination (ND) was written for this award (GFO-0011122-001; 6/14/2024; CXs: A9, A11, B3.6) covering Tasks 1 through 5, including Subtask 5.1, and Subtasks 6.1 and 6.2. This ND would cover Subtasks 5.2.2.1 and 5.2.2.2.

Activities under the current review would be limited to institute management, project management, techno-economic analysis/life cycle assessment, and laboratory-scale activities.
